Timer circuit
The µPC617 is a powerful integrated circuit. Adding a few external parts to it can turn it into various types of timing signal generators, such as monostable and astable multivibrators. It has trigger, threshold, and control pins.
Inputting a signal to the reset pin can stop the circuit operation easily. In addition, the output can sink current as high as 200 mA (maximum). So, it can be used to drive relays and lamps.
